60;;
61; Jump table for trap handlers for hypervisor traps.
62;
63g_apfnStaticTrapHandlersHyper:
64 ; N - M M - T - C - D i
65 ; o - n o - y - o - e p
66 ; - e n - p - d - s t
67 ; - i - e - e - c .
68 ; - c - - - r
69 ; =============================================================
70 dd 0 ; 0 - #DE - F - N - Divide error
71 dd NAME(TRPMGCTrap01Handler) ; 1 - #DB - F/T - N - Single step, INT 1 instruction
72%ifdef VBOX_WITH_NMI
73 dd NAME(TRPMGCTrap02Handler) ; 2 - - I - N - Non-Maskable Interrupt (NMI)
74%else
75 dd 0 ; 2 - - I - N - Non-Maskable Interrupt (NMI)
76%endif
77 dd NAME(TRPMGCTrap03Handler) ; 3 - #BP - T - N - Breakpoint, INT 3 instruction.
78 dd 0 ; 4 - #OF - T - N - Overflow, INTO instruction.
79 dd 0 ; 5 - #BR - F - N - BOUND Range Exceeded, BOUND instruction.
80 dd 0 ; 6 - #UD - F - N - Undefined(/Invalid) Opcode.
81 dd 0 ; 7 - #NM - F - N - Device not available, FP or (F)WAIT instruction.
82 dd 0 ; 8 - #DF - A - 0 - Double fault.
83 dd 0 ; 9 - - F - N - Coprocessor Segment Overrun (obsolete).
84 dd 0 ; a - #TS - F - Y - Invalid TSS, Taskswitch or TSS access.
85 dd NAME(TRPMGCHyperTrap0bHandler) ; b - #NP - F - Y - Segment not present.
86 dd 0 ; c - #SS - F - Y - Stack-Segment fault.
87 dd NAME(TRPMGCHyperTrap0dHandler) ; d - #GP - F - Y - General protection fault.
88 dd NAME(TRPMGCHyperTrap0eHandler) ; e - #PF - F - Y - Page fault.
89 dd 0 ; f - - - - Intel Reserved. Do not use.
90 dd 0 ; 10 - #MF - F - N - x86 FPU Floating-Point Error (Math fault), FP or (F)WAIT instruction.
91 dd 0 ; 11 - #AC - F - 0 - Alignment Check.
92 dd 0 ; 12 - #MC - A - N - Machine Check.
93 dd 0 ; 13 - #XF - F - N - SIMD Floating-Point Exception.
94 dd 0 ; 14 - - - - Intel Reserved. Do not use.
95 dd 0 ; 15 - - - - Intel Reserved. Do not use.
96 dd 0 ; 16 - - - - Intel Reserved. Do not use.
97 dd 0 ; 17 - - - - Intel Reserved. Do not use.
98 dd 0 ; 18 - - - - Intel Reserved. Do not use.

960;;
961; Trap handler for double fault (#DF).
962;
963; This is a special trap handler executes in separate task with own TSS, with
964; one of the intermediate memory contexts instead of the shadow context.
965; The handler will unconditionally print an report to the comport configured
966; for the COM_S_* macros before attempting to return to the host. If it it ends
967; up double faulting more than 10 times, it will simply cause an tripple fault
968; to get us out of the mess.
969;
970; @param esp Half way down the hypvervisor stack + the trap frame.
971; @param ebp Half way down the hypvervisor stack.
972; @param eflags Interrupts disabled, nested flag is probably set (we don't care).
973; @param ecx The address of the hypervisor TSS.
974; @param edi Same as ecx.
975; @param eax Same as ecx.
976; @param edx Address of the VM structure.
977; @param esi Same as edx.
978; @param ebx Same as edx.
979; @param ss Hypervisor DS.
980; @param ds Hypervisor DS.
981; @param es Hypervisor DS.
982; @param fs 0
983; @param gs 0
984;
985;
986; @remark To be able to catch errors with WP turned off, it is required that the
987; TSS GDT descriptor and the TSSes are writable (X86_PTE_RW). See SELM.cpp
988; for how to enable this.
989;
990; @remark It is *not* safe to resume the VMM after a double fault. (At least not
991; without clearing the busy flag of the TssTrap8 and fixing whatever cause it.)
992;
